What Is Mom's Kitchen PNW and Why It Matters

Mom's Kitchen PNW refers to home-based and small-scale food operations run by mothers and caregivers across the Pacific Northwest, including Washington, Oregon, and parts of Idaho. These businesses range from cottage food producers and meal prep services to catering and direct-to-consumer sales, and they form a visible part of the region's local food ecosystem. Data from the U.S. Census Bureau and state licensing agencies show that small food establishments, including home-based ones, make up a large share of food businesses in the region, and many are led by women and mothers. Forbes reports that small food businesses in the Pacific Northwest have grown steadily as consumers seek local, homemade options.

Regulatory frameworks in Washington and Oregon allow home-based food operations under specific cottage food laws, which define permitted foods, labeling rules, and sales limits. In Washington, the Department of Agriculture oversees cottage food permits, while Oregon's Food Safety Program sets similar rules for home kitchens. These regulations help mom-run kitchens operate legally while ensuring food safety standards are met. Small food businesses in the Pacific Northwest contribute to local economies through direct sales, farmers market participation, and online ordering platforms. Many mom-run kitchens focus on high-margin, specialty products such as baked goods, fermented foods, sauces, and meal kits that appeal to health-conscious consumers. The rise of e-commerce and social media marketing has lowered barriers for these operators, allowing them to reach customers beyond their immediate neighborhoods. Forbes notes that social media and digital storefronts have become essential tools for small food businesses to scale sales.

Employment and income data from the Bureau of Labor Statistics and state labor agencies show that food service and food manufacturing remain among the largest employment sectors in Washington and Oregon. While most mom-run kitchens operate as sole proprietorships or micro-businesses, successful ones often hire additional help, source ingredients locally, and collaborate with regional farms. This creates a multiplier effect that supports local agriculture, packaging suppliers, and delivery services. How Mom's Kitchen PNW Businesses Operate and Scale

Most mom-run kitchen businesses in the Pacific Northwest start with a clear product focus, such as sourdough, pastries, fermented vegetables, or prepared meals, and rely on repeat customers and word-of-mouth growth. They typically operate under cottage food permits, sell at farmers markets, use online ordering platforms, and partner with local retailers or co-ops.
